Goldman Sachs, founded in 1869 by Marcus Goldman and later joined by Samuel Sachs, is a premier global investment bank headquartered in New York City, renowned for its influential role in financial markets. The firm provides a wide range of services, including investment banking (mergers, acquisitions, and underwriting), securities trading, asset management, and consumer banking through its Marcus platform, catering to corporations, governments, institutions, and high-net-worth individuals. Known for its elite status on Wall Street, Goldman Sachs has a history of navigating major economic events, from the Great Depression to the 2008 financial crisis, where it played a controversial yet pivotal role. With a strong emphasis on innovation and a global footprint, it manages billions in assets and remains a powerhouse in shaping economic policy and market trends.

Goldman Sachs's Q1 2016 Portfolio in Review

As of Q1 2016, Goldman Sachs held 7,717 positions worth $304B, down 4.6% from $319B the previous quarter. Its ten largest holdings account for 15% of the portfolio.

Goldman Sachs withdrew a net $11.3B in Q1 2016, closing 656 positions and reducing 3,244 holdings. Its most notable exit was CHUBB CORPORATION, an estimated $383M position sold in full.

By sector, the portfolio is most concentrated in Financials at 8.6% of assets, down from 9.2% a quarter earlier, followed by Technology and Healthcare.

Against the trend, Goldman Sachs opened a new position in Welbilt, Inc. worth $36.5M.

  • Goldman Sachs's largest Q1 2016 buy was Welbilt, Inc.: 2,476,061 shares worth $36.5M.
  • Goldman Sachs added most to Pfizer in Q1 2016, an estimated $1.62B increase.
  • Goldman Sachs's biggest Q1 2016 reduction was Zimmer Biomet, cutting an estimated $2.63B.
  • Goldman Sachs fully exited CHUBB CORPORATION in Q1 2016, selling an estimated $383M.
  • Goldman Sachs's ten largest holdings make up 15% of its $304B portfolio in Q1 2016.
  • Goldman Sachs opened 593 new positions and closed 656 in Q1 2016.
  • Goldman Sachs's portfolio value fell 4.6% quarter-over-quarter to $304B.

Based on Goldman Sachs's 13F filing for Q1 2016, filed 13 May 2016.
